DIVA ON THE RISE! Ashley Adams Launches Black Prana Magazine: The First Publication For Yogis Of Color — WATCH!
By Delaina Dixon | April 12, 2021 | FitnessDuring the height of the pandemic Ashley Adams, 500 RYT, studio owner, YTT curriculum producer, wife and mom saw the perfect opportunity to launch her passion project: Black Prana Magazine. This labor is love is the first publication dedicated, created, produced by and for Black and BIPOC yoga teachers and practitioners. I spoke to her about her journey and how she continues to do it all.
As a yogi who has been studying for over 10 years I have to admit it, it has occurred to me more than once that I was “the only” on the mat in class, but I grew up like that so there is a numbing effect that just exists. However, over the last few years that numbness many of us “onlys” have lived with is melting quickly, birthing some beautiful spaces for us.
Ashley didn’t let the numbness, non-inclusive yoga industry stop her from launching a much-needed outlet. She’s not only created a space, but she’s brought together a TRIBE! Check her journey below.
